Saturday 27 July, in La Thuile, in Valle d’Aosta, an unmissable appointment with the now consolidated event that has fascinated trail runners for years: the eighth edition of La Thuile Trail. Three beautiful and technical routes in the high mountains – 25km, Marathon 42km and Ultra 70km – develop in a highly emotional setting, in a wild nature that offers an extraordinary spectacle for the eyes and the heart, in a part of the Valdigne enclosed between the Ruitor glacier and the Mont Blanc chain. Athletes of twenty nationalities will be at the start, including around a hundred international ones, and many leading names from the trail world. Registrations are open until July 25th or when the maximum number of participants is reached.

“With almost 500 athletes registered one month before the event, we have already exceeded last year’s number of participants, a great source of pride for all those involved. If we consider that it is physiological for many runners to register on time, it is more than likely that we can think of reaching 800 participants,” comments Mattia Jacquemod, member of the organizing committee.

Here are some of the sure protagonists…

Among the women: Sarah Mc Cormack, Irish athlete (registered for the 25km), fourth place at Sierre Zinal 2022; Toni McCann (entered in the 42km) – Adidas Terrex, Suunto, Maurten and Red Bull South Africa athlete – who won the OCC at UTMB in 2023 and all the last five races she has contested including Transvulcania and Ultra Trail Cape Town.
Among the men: Ross Gollan athlete from the United Kingdom (registered for the 25km), third last year in the 25km; Michael Dola, Team Scarpa and Ethic athlete, who in 2022 took fourth place behind Blanchard, Cheraz and Borgialli in the 60k La Thuile Trail and, more recently, in June 2024 won the Trail Oasi Zegna 70km; Marco Biondi fresh from first place at Brunello Crossing (February 2024); Alessandro Macellaro (registered for the 42km) who climbed to the top step of the podium in 2023 in the 50km of the Trail Oasi Zegna; Bastien Perez, Team All Triangles – The North Face, (entered for the 25km) who recently won the 35km Ultra Trail of Cape Town.
